Hezbollah claims to be the furthest point in Israel hit by rockets since 2023

Hezbollah said it attacked the Ramat David airbase in northern Israel, the first time it has fired rockets in that direction, Al Jazeera television reported, citing the movement’s statement.

“Hezbollah issued a statement claiming responsibility for the attack on the Ramat David airbase east of Haifa… This is the first time Hezbollah has fired rockets into the area.” – says the channel’s message.

It should be noted that this is the most attacked point since the escalation of the conflict with Israel since October 2023.

Hezbollah said in a statement that this was in response to attacks on several regions and areas of Lebanon and the deaths of civilians.

Communications equipment, including pagers and walkie-talkies, was detonated in different parts of Lebanon on September 17 and 18. According to official figures, 37 people were killed and more than 3,000 injured. The Iranian ambassador to Lebanon was among the victims. Mojtaba AmaniIt is not yet known what caused the simultaneous explosion of thousands of devices. Hezbollah, Lebanese authorities and Iran have blamed Israel for the incident. Israeli authorities have yet to confirm or deny their involvement.
